### Step 4 — Point Herald at the new deploy API

Okay, this is the fiddly bit. Herald (our deploy-status chat bot) still polls the old Shipgate endpoint, which goes away Friday. Swap it to the new events feed, bump the poll interval so we don't hammer it, and turn on the channel-per-environment routing everyone asked for at sync. Test in the sandbox room first. Herald should come up with exactly the following configuration.

service settings:
PRAWYN_PIN=9848
PRAWYN_METRICS_HOST=metrics.prawyn.lumicworks.corp
PRAWYN_LOG_LEVEL=warn
PRAWYN_TENANT=pelius

Handover — Gridlark CSV import wizard

Taking over from me: wizard is stable, but watch the delimiter sniffer — it guesses wrong on semicolon files under 1 KB. Workaround is telling users to pick the delimiter manually in step two. Batch imports over 50k rows queue through the Tarnwell worker; anything stuck longer than ten minutes means the worker died, just restart it. Escalations go to the data platform rotation. Current production settings for the import service are as follows:

config for tagep-yajef:
ulawyn:
  log_level: error
  metrics_host: metrics.ulawyn.lumiclabs.internal
  pin: 0564
  pool_size: 32

Team, as discussed, we are rotating the Relaybird credential used by the webhook dispatcher. Note that retry semantics are unchanged: failed deliveries still back off exponentially (1s, 4s, 16s, capped at five attempts), and a rotated key mid-retry does not invalidate queued attempts, since tokens are resolved at send time. Please confirm your local `.env` files are updated before Thursday so we avoid silent 401 loops in the retry queue. The new staging key follows.

API key for kagef-hawip: vxb23-Pr8vHMY75zw7FNCkIRjgNOi

## Further reading

So you've got Ledgerscope running locally — nice. The viewer itself is pretty simple: it streams audit events from the Cobbleton pipeline and renders them with filters. Most of the confusing stuff (retention tiers, redaction rules, why some events show up twice) is covered in the team docs. Before filing a bug, skim the known-quirks list, which lives on this internal page.

dashboard of kafop-yagep = https://jira.zemvarsys.internal/pages/pages/pages/display/cc87